Chimneyville (1977)

Chimneyville was an imprint of Malaco records, a soul outfit from Jackson, Mississippi. I first saw this nice bricked-up label on a grimy King Floyd 45 I found at a thrift store in Alabama. Man did King Floyd jam me out. I was just getting into southern soul, and that 45 felt so good, like James Brown had run headlong into a nasty, smoked-out, reggae-flavored Stax session. Anyway, this is not that record, but it's a much cleaner label than that King Floyd joint, which looked like it was used for target practice.
